Noun

(ぶん)()(りょう)(どう) (bunbu ryōdō

  1. The quality of excelling at both the path of military arts and that of literary arts.
    (たけ)()(しん)(げん)(ぶん)()(りょう)(どう)(めい)(しょう)であった。
    Takeda Shingen wa bunbu ryōdō no meishō de atta.
    Takeda Shingen was a great commander excelling at both the path of military arts and that of literary arts.
